Output 7bd75fa50840383744e4e7c1ef641a3ea8b8b358c137786d9e54d89e36826c86:18

value
349417611
script pubkey
OP_0 OP_PUSHBYTES_32 def9078269541e9db6012a3150096ec0a698dc83a5d3cde514610064d2d4ec72
address
bc1qmmus0qnf2s0fmdsp9gc4qztwcznf3hyr5hfumeg5vyqxf5k5a3eq62wey8
transaction
7bd75fa50840383744e4e7c1ef641a3ea8b8b358c137786d9e54d89e36826c86
spent
true